
The Samsung Galaxy S8 comes with 4GB of RAM in most countries it is available in, although there is also a 6GB version of the handset which is available in some countries. This higher RAM variant is designed to offer enhanced performance, particularly for power users who engage in heavy multitasking or gaming.
Samsung Galaxy S8 with 6GB RAM Launches in India
Now Samsung has announced that the 6GB of RAM version of the Samsung Galaxy S8 smartphone is coming to India. This version of the handset also comes with 128GB of built-in storage, providing ample space for apps, photos, videos, and other data. The increased storage capacity is particularly beneficial for users who prefer to keep a large amount of media and files on their device without relying on cloud storage.
Samsung will start taking pre-orders on the Galaxy S8 with 6GB of RAM and 128GB of storage in India from tomorrow. The handset will be available in Midnight Black, a color that has been popular among consumers for its sleek and elegant appearance. It will be sold on Flipkart, one of India’s leading e-commerce platforms, and also on Samsung’s online store in India.
Pricing and Availability
The Samsung Galaxy S8 with 6GB of RAM will cost the equivalent of $1,162 in India. This price point positions it as a premium device, catering to consumers who are willing to invest in a high-end smartphone with advanced features. The handset will officially launch in the country on the 9th of June, making it available to Indian consumers who have been eagerly awaiting this enhanced version of the Galaxy S8.

In addition to the increased RAM and storage, the Samsung Galaxy S8 boasts a range of impressive features that have contributed to its popularity worldwide. These include a stunning 5.8-inch Quad HD+ Super AMOLED display, which offers vibrant colors and deep blacks, making it ideal for media consumption. The device is powered by the Exynos 8895 processor (or the Snapdragon 835 in some regions), ensuring smooth and efficient performance.
The Galaxy S8 also features a 12-megapixel rear camera with Dual Pixel technology, which provides fast and accurate autofocus, even in low-light conditions. The front-facing 8-megapixel camera is equipped with smart autofocus and facial recognition, making it perfect for selfies and video calls. Additionally, the handset includes an iris scanner and facial recognition for enhanced security, as well as IP68 water and dust resistance, ensuring durability in various environments.
